What Is Accident Management Service?


Management of an accident is not easy because there are many forms to sign and documents to submit. In addition, the claims process can also be a problem. Managing claims accident alone can take a toll on anyone. This is the reason why many claims company offer their services to car accident victims wherein they will do the work for a fee. There are many benefits of this service to the motorists.

Accident management service covers a lot of things. It includes damage assessment, vehicle repair arrangement and 24-hour vehicle recovery. Under this service, the company will also negotiate with the car insurers, help victims with the paperwork and assist clients process their personal injury claims. Each company may add more services.

Clients should study these services being offered by the company before getting their service. This cost-effective intermediary service being offered to motorists is definitely effective. People can easily find companies which offer such services through the internet. Many companies offer service to the victim of non fault accident. Their service fee is usually high but you do not need to worry though, because the person at fault of the accident will pay.


In the past, companies offer their decentralized services to drivers who are not at fault on the accident. However, many companies these days also offer the same kind of service even to those who are at fault on the car accident. Some of the services being offered are 24 claims help line, vehicle inspection, uninsured loss recovery, 24 hour vehicle recovery service and like for like replacement for non-fault accident claims. Before signing up with a claim company that offers accident management service read their terms and conditions first. This is to avoid any legal problems in the future.

Examples of companies associated with claims companies that offer management services are credit hire companies, credit repair companies and motor insurance claims. Credit hire operators provide replacement vehicles to victims of car accidents. They can also arrange for the repair of the car and recover the cost from the person at fault. These services are offered on credit. Credit repair companies as the name implies will arrange for the repair of the car of the victim in any repair garage approved by the company.

Now the on purpose car accidents and the clay falling off a truck are just two common problems that happen to drivers up and down the country all the time and the downside is that you end up getting penalized by the insurance company even when it was clearly not your fault. You very often have to pay excess fees, many policies don't offer a free car rental and worst of all your insurance premium goes up because you wind up losing your no claims bonus.

There is however, a remedy which I did not know about until recently which acts as an added insurance to protect against accidents which are not your fault. The way it works is if you are unlucky enough to be in this situation the accident management company will deal with the claim on your behalf and you won't have to lose any no claims bonus, pay excess fees or be faced with higher future payments. Many accident management companies also offer you a free car rental within twenty four hours and if your car is written off you are allowed to keep using the car rental until your paid out. Each company varies slightly in exactly what they have to offer but the points just mentioned seem to be common benefits to this type of insurance
